Output 79e7ce1d7320de9a65893d3f14999926324c3044c800acd14f5fd2ec53ced55f:0

value
1623883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37604223f29b980dcae0b5303bd6c8721f602 OP_EQUAL
address
3BMEXepMbfW8Fbnax949aCzGuHVGZa6Q4N
transaction
79e7ce1d7320de9a65893d3f14999926324c3044c800acd14f5fd2ec53ced55f
confirmations
341964
spent
true